Class MetalDesktopIconUI
- java.lang.Object
-
- javax.swing.plaf.ComponentUI
-
- javax.swing.plaf.DesktopIconUI
-
- javax.swing.plaf.basic.BasicDesktopIconUI
-
- javax.swing.plaf.metal.MetalDesktopIconUI
public class MetalDesktopIconUI extends BasicDesktopIconUI
Metal desktop icon.
Nested Class Summary
Nested classes/interfaces declared in class javax.swing.plaf.basic.BasicDesktopIconUI
BasicDesktopIconUI.MouseInputHandler
Field Summary
Fields declared in class javax.swing.plaf.basic.BasicDesktopIconUI
desktopIcon, frame, iconPane
Constructor Summary
Constructor | Description |
---|---|
MetalDesktopIconUI() | Constructs a new instance of |
Method Summary
Modifier and Type | Method | Description |
---|---|---|
static ComponentUI | createUI(JComponent c) | Constructs a new instance of |
Methods declared in class javax.swing.plaf.basic.BasicDesktopIconUI
createMouseInputListener, deiconize, getInsets, getMaximumSize, installComponents, installDefaults, installListeners, uninstallComponents, uninstallDefaults, uninstallListeners
Methods declared in class javax.swing.plaf.ComponentUI
contains, getAccessibleChild, getAccessibleChildrenCount, getBaseline, getBaselineResizeBehavior, getMinimumSize, getPreferredSize, installUI, paint, uninstallUI, update
Methods declared in class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Constructor Detail
MetalDesktopIconUI
public MetalDesktopIconUI()
Constructs a new instance of MetalDesktopIconUI
.
Method Detail
createUI
public static ComponentUI createUI(JComponent c)
Constructs a new instance of MetalDesktopIconUI
.
- Parameters:
-
c
- a component - Returns:
- a new instance of
MetalDesktopIconUI